The Countdown Begins
With just eight days until the trade window opens, the anticipation is palpable. The Philadelphia Eagles, who currently hold Brown's contract, can initiate the trade process on June 2, and most insiders believe it's only a matter of time before Brown finds himself in new surroundings.

The Rams' Missed Opportunity
The Los Angeles Rams had their chance to acquire Brown back in March but decided against it due to medical concerns and the fully guaranteed $24 million contract for Davante Adams in 2026. This decision seems to have closed the door on any potential Rams-Brown reunion.
